Obituary of Betty Taylor

Betty was born in Saint John on September 30, 1938; she was the daughter of the late Alan and Muriel (Miller) Albert and was the wife of the late Gordon Taylor who passed away in 1987.

Betty was a former nurses aide having worked at the Saint John Provincial Hospital and the Loch Lomond Nursing Home. She was an active member of the Royal Canadian Legion Sussex Branch #20 for many years.


Over Betty's many years with our Legion she was involved in many areas. Betty was involved with Bingo, Entertainment, Poppy Campaign, she organized and looked after the Craft Sale every November for a number of years as well as our in house Flea Markets, she worked in the kitchen and was chairman of our Shuffleboard league for many years and in past years when called upon to do so helped at the door of many dances and other functions selling 50/50 tickets and signing people in.  If there was a job Betty could help she was there.  Betty was on the Executive for many years staying involved even when she was having her own difficulties.

Betty will live on in the hearts of her daughter, Ella-May Connors and her husband Phillip of Wards Creek; two grandchildren: Megan and Kathleen; her brother, Joe Albert and Diana Stewart of Stewarton,
nieces: Laura Albert, Linda McCormick and her husband David, Brenda Tingley, Lisa Gallagher, Debbie Losier and her husband David; nephews: Alan Albert,  Ronald Taylor, Carl Gallagher and his wife Noreen; and Donnie Gaudet who boarded with her.

Elizabeth Dorothy Taylor of Sussex passed away at the Sussex Health Center on October 5, 2009 at the age of 71.
